The main difference between UPS and a stabilizer is that a stabilizer only regulates voltage stability, while a UPS not only stabilizes voltage but also provides backup power in case of outages. These devices play significant roles in safeguarding electrical equipment, but they differ. . How much power does a home battery have?
Some batteries offer just 3–5 kW of power—enough for lights, a fridge, and a few other essentials. Quality home battery systems are modular, which means that you can scale both energy storage capacity and output power based on your needs.

How much power does a battery need?
Power and energy requirements are different: Your battery must handle both daily energy consumption (kWh) and peak power demands (kW). A home using 30 kWh daily might need 8-12 kW of instantaneous power when multiple appliances run simultaneously.
